Staying Organized: Tools for Time Management and Planning
These apps are beneficial as staying organized reduces stress and keeps students and parents proactive rather than reactive.
Students:
- Google Calendar: This is perfect for scheduling classes, assignments, and study sessions. Its notifications help ensure that deadlines aren’t missed and that students are well organized.
- My Study Life: A student-focused planner that tracks homework, exams, and schedules in one place. It is a popular and easy-to-use app with some great features.
Parents:
- Cozi Family Organizer: Life is busy! This app will help you manage family schedules, track assignments, and coordinate activities to keep everyone on the same page.
- Todoist: A simple yet effective to-do list app for managing tasks and priorities for the whole family. Suitable for grocery lists and meal planning, too!
Mastering the Material: Study and Learning Apps
These interactive and engaging resources adapt to different learning styles, making it easier for students to understand and retain information.
Students:
- Quizlet: Create digital flashcards or use pre-made sets created by teachers, students and educational experts to practice vocabulary, concepts, or exam prep.
- Khan Academy: Offers free lessons, videos, and practice exercises on various subjects, from reading and math to art history and trigonometry.
Parents:
- Duolingo: Encourage language learning as a family and make it fun with quick, easy lessons, games, and challenges that keep everyone engaged and motivated.
- BrainPOP: Engaging videos and quizzes on various topics make learning accessible and enjoyable for younger students.
Help with Writing Assignments: Tools for Better Communication
Clear and confident writing is an important skill to develop, and these tools make it easier for students to learn proper writing techniques and express their ideas effectively.
Students:
- Grammarly: A writing assistant that checks for grammar, spelling, and clarity in essays and assignments. It can also help to generate ideas when you’re stuck.
- Hemingway Editor Simplifies writing by identifying overly lengthy or complex sentences and improving readability. The suggestions are coded, making finding mistakes and fixing them easy.
Parents:
- ProWritingAid: A tool to review your child’s work for structure and tone. This app highlights strengths and weaknesses in writing and offers suggestions for improving it.
- Google Docs: An easy-to-use collaborative platform where parents can assist in reviewing and editing their child’s assignments in real time. Also great for students to utilize for group projects.

Maintaining Focus: Tools to Stay on Track
Limits distractions from apps and websites to create a more productive study environment, allowing students to maximize their time.
Students:
- Forest: Grow virtual trees by staying off your phone while you study. It’s a fun way to build focus and avoid distractions. You can also earn virtual coins and donate them to plant real trees worldwide.
- Focus@Will: Provides music scientifically designed to enhance concentration and productivity. Studies have shown a 200-400% increase in focus time with active users.
Parents:
- OurPact: Manage screen time for the whole family by setting schedules and blocking apps during study hours. It also features GPS and website filters.
- Freedom: Blocks distractions across all devices, helping the household stay focused when needed.
